About The Opportunity
The MDR Technician performs cleaning and sterilizing duties to meet the needs of departmental customers. They follow policies and procedures of the service and rotate throughout the decontamination area, processing area and distribution area. Included in this area will be the make-up and distribution of case carts and other sterile items to both internal and external partners/clients within Nova Scotia Health. Additional duties may be assigned by the manager as deemed necessary. This position includes evening, nights and weekend shifts.
About You
We would love to hear from you if you have the following:
- High school graduation or equivalent required
- Successful completion of a recognized medical device reprocessing education program required
- Certified Medical Device Reprocessing Technician preferred
- Medical device reprocessing experience preferred
- Experience with instrumentation, medical knowledge and terminology, infection control and sterile processing practices, case cart make up, knowledge of pick lists will be required
- Knowledge of basic infection control and personal safety measures is required
- Ability to stand for long periods, lift trays and other articles of approximately 25lbs in weight, and the ability to move a rolling weight in excess of 50lbs required
- Ability to set priorities and organize workload required
- Excellent communication skills, interpersonal skills, organizational skills as well as the ability to work independently as required
- Ability to establish and maintain good working relationships with customers and staff required
- Ability to hold in confidence all matters pertaining to MDRD, patients and staff is required
- An equivalent combination of education and experience may be considered for this position
- Competencies in other languages an asset, French preferred
Where there are no applicants who have completed the Medical Device Reprocessing Technician Program, consideration for a Medical Device Reprocessing in Training position may be given to applicants who are enrolled in an approved Medical Device Reprocessing Technician Program and are willing to successfully complete this program at their own expense within 12 months of employment. Candidates must be enrolled in a recognized medical device reprocessing education program at the time of hire.
Hours
- Permanent full-time position; 75 hours biweekly
- Shift work (including days, evenings, nights, weekends and holidays)
- On-call required
$21.79 - $24.68 Hourly
